Lancaster Caramel Company facts for kids
The Lancaster Caramel Company was a candy business started by Milton S. Hershey in Lancaster, Pennsylvania, in 1886. It was his first successful candy company. This company helped Milton Hershey become well-known before he created the famous Hershey's chocolate.

The Start of a Sweet Business
Milton Hershey first set up his caramel company in a warehouse. This place was on South Duke Street in Lancaster. However, it didn't have the right equipment to cook caramels. So, Hershey soon moved his business to an old factory. This factory was on Church Street and used to be an electric plant.
The first few months were very hard for the company. But then, a candy importer from Britain placed a big order. Also, a bank helped Hershey get a loan. This allowed him to buy the supplies he needed. As the business grew, Hershey used more parts of the factory building. By 1894, the Lancaster Caramel Company had about 1,300 workers.
Growing Across the Country
In 1891, Hershey bought some land and a small factory. This was in Mount Joy, Pennsylvania. The new factory quickly started making caramels. In 1892, the Lancaster Caramel Company grew even more. It opened a new branch in Chicago. This branch later moved to Bloomington, Illinois. The Bloomington factory made caramels until 1900. It was then sold to another company. Soon after opening the Chicago branch, Hershey started a third caramel factory. This one was in Reading, Pennsylvania.
Selling the Caramel Business
The Lancaster Caramel Company officially became a corporation on February 8, 1894. At this time, the Hershey Chocolate Company was also created. It was a smaller company owned by the caramel business. In the spring of 1900, Milton Hershey thought caramels were just a passing trend. He believed that chocolate had a much bigger future.
So, he sold his entire caramel business. This included the factory, machines, candy recipes, and all the caramels he had. He sold it for $1 million in cash to the American Caramel Company. Milton Hershey kept only the Hershey Chocolate Company. He also kept the chocolate-making equipment. This allowed him to focus completely on making chocolate.
The American Caramel Company
How It Began
The American Caramel Company grew from a business started in 1867. Peter C. Wiest was a pioneer in making caramels. He built a very successful company. In 1878, Daniel F. Lafean joined as a partner. Their company was called P. C. Wiest & Company. Peter C. Wiest later retired from the business. In 1895, the P. C. Wiest Company became a corporation. Daniel F. Lafean was its president.
Lafean was key in creating the American Caramel Company. It was formed on March 28, 1898. This happened when the Breisch-Hine Company from Philadelphia merged with The P. C. Wiest & Company from York, Pennsylvania. The main office of the American Caramel Company was in York.
Becoming Famous
The American Caramel Company became very famous after buying the Lancaster Caramel Company in 1900. They became well-known for including baseball and other cards with their candies. With the addition of the Lancaster Caramel Company, the American Caramel Company became huge. They controlled about 90% of all the caramels made in the country.
The American Caramel Company was one of the first businesses to put Baseball Cards with their products. In December 1928, the American Caramel Company closed its York Plant. They moved their candy-making machines to a more modern factory.
